There are many different types of retaining walls in Woodstock GA, each with its own advantages and disadvantages. Some of the most common types of retaining walls include:
- Gravity retaining walls: Gravity retaining walls are the simplest type of retaining wall to build. They are made of heavy materials, such as concrete or stone, and rely on their own weight to hold back the soil.
- Cantilever retaining walls: Cantilever retaining walls are more complex to build than gravity retaining walls, but they can support more soil. They are made of a concrete or steel L-shaped beam that is embedded in the ground.
- Sheet pile retaining walls: Sheet pile retaining walls are made of interlocking sheets of metal that are driven into the ground. They are often used in areas with high water tables or unstable soils.
Retaining walls offer several benefits, including:
- Erosion control: Retaining walls can help to control erosion by preventing soil from washing away.
- Slope stabilization: Retaining walls can help to stabilize slopes and prevent landslides.
- Water drainage: Retaining walls can help to improve water drainage by diverting water away from buildings and other structures.
- Aesthetic appeal: Retaining walls can add aesthetic appeal to your property and increase its value.
When choosing a retaining wall, it is important to consider the following factors:
- The height of the wall: The height of the wall will determine the type of retaining wall that is needed.
- The soil type: The type of soil will also determine the type of retaining wall that is needed.
- The budget: The budget will also play a role in choosing the right retaining wall.
